5 Things to Do in Goose Creek Before School Starts

Last chance to build summer memories before school starts.

Summer is almost over in Goose Creek, and if you'd like to get the most out of your kid's summer before school starts, here's a list for you. 

School starts Aug. 19.

  • Enjoy the water at Wannamaker Park. You can go cheap with $1 entry at the gate and enjoy the Sprinkler, or you can spring for the $19.99 entry fee for the Whirlin' Waters Adventure Park. Either way, you can't go wrong with water in this August heat.
  • Help others get ready for school with the district's Stuff the Bus. Stuff the Bus continues this week. The campaign will conclude with a finale event on 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. Tuesday, Aug. 13, from at both the Moncks Corner and Goose Creek Wal-Mart locations featuring music, games, food and more.
  • Enjoy more water at the Goose Creek city pool at Crowfield. Day passes are $5 per person. Click here for more information. Pool closes Sept. 15.
  • Go fishing at Bushy Park. Summer memories are ready to be caught by getting a line and a pole, and sitting by the water at Bushy Park. Admission is free and so are the fish. Just bring a chair, fishing gear, and possibly a picnic. 
  • Catch up on summer reading outside under your favorite tree, or at a public area like the Goose Creek Municipal Center.
